Cutting the deck is not the step that produces the game result when dealing with physical cards. The provably fair algorithms present you, the player, with the opportunity to “cut the deck”, so you can be sure any future games using that seed pair will be random. In a previous article, I gave a very simple explanation of what provably fair is and why it’s important. This is always the very first step in a process that can have infinite steps afterwards. The verification process used by most sites goes only as far as proving that the casino did not change the server seed after you placed your bet. The more complicated the game’s rules are, the more complicated the process is to get that game’s results. Some are very simple, with only a few steps, while others are required to convert the provably fair hash string to perform very long and complicated math functions. The provably fair algorithm is only one part of the process used to generate the game results you see on your screen. How can a game pass fairness verification if it’s not fair?
